excel区域引用有什么特点
作者:路由通
|
326人看过
发布时间:2025-11-01 17:43:22
标签:
区域引用是表格处理软件中最基础也最核心的概念之一,它定义了公式计算和数据操作的具体范围。深入理解其特点,能极大提升数据处理效率与公式构建的准确性。本文将系统阐述区域引用的十二项关键特性,包括其相对性与绝对性、三维引用能力、动态扩展优势以及在函数中的核心应用,辅以贴近实际工作的案例,帮助用户彻底掌握这一强大工具。
在日常使用表格处理软件进行工作时,无论是简单的求和、平均值计算,还是复杂的数据透视表制作,我们都离不开一个基础而关键的概念——区域引用。它就像是我们在数据海洋中绘制的一张精确地图,告诉软件我们需要对哪些单元格进行操作。很多朋友可能只是停留在“选中一片格子”的初步认识上,但真正掌握区域引用的精妙之处,却能让我们从重复劳动的泥潭中解脱出来,实现工作效率的质的飞跃。今天,我们就来深入探讨一下区域引用所具备的那些重要特点。 一、区域引用的基本构成与表示方法 区域引用最直观的特点在于其简洁明了的表示法。它通常由该区域左上角单元格的地址和右下角单元格的地址组成,中间用冒号连接。例如,引用“A1到B5”这个矩形区域,就写作“A1:B5”。这种表示方法非常符合人类的视觉认知习惯,我们一眼就能看出它涵盖了两列五行共十个单元格。它不仅用于手动输入公式,更是我们通过鼠标拖动选择区域时,软件自动生成的格式,是人与软件交互的基础语言。 案例一:当我们需要计算A列第1行到第10行这十个数字的总和时,我们会在目标单元格中输入公式“=SUM(A1:A10)”。这里的“A1:A10”就是一个典型的区域引用,它明确指定了求和函数的作用范围。 案例二:如果我们需要选中一个不规则的较大区域,例如从C列第3行到F列第20行,我们只需用鼠标点击C3单元格,然后按住左键拖动至F20单元格松开,软件界面和公式编辑栏中就会清晰地显示出被选中的区域“C3:F20”。 二、引用性质的相对性 区域引用具备天生的相对性。这意味着,当我们将一个包含区域引用的公式从一个单元格复制到另一个单元格时,公式中的引用会根据新单元格相对于原单元格的位置偏移而发生自动变化。这种设计在处理规律性数据时极为高效,它能避免我们手动修改成千上万个公式的繁琐劳动。 案例一:在单元格B1中输入公式“=SUM(A1:A10)”计算A列的十行数据之和。如果我们将B1单元格的公式向下拖动复制到B2单元格,B2单元格的公式会自动变为“=SUM(A2:A11)”。这是因为复制方向是向下移动了一行,所以引用的区域也整体向下偏移了一行。 案例二:如果在C5单元格中输入公式“=A1+B2”,将其向右复制到D5单元格,则D5的公式会变成“=B1+C2”。引用关系保持了原有的相对位置,但具体的单元格地址发生了对应的变化。 三、引用性质的绝对性 与相对性相对应,区域引用可以通过添加美元符号($)来实现绝对引用。绝对引用可以“锁定”行号、列标或同时锁定两者。无论公式被复制到任何位置,绝对引用的部分将始终保持不变。这在需要固定参照某个特定单元格或区域(如税率、单价等常量)时至关重要。 案例一:假设D1单元格存放着一个固定的税率值0.05。我们在B2单元格输入公式“=A2$D$1”来计算A2单元格金额对应的税额。当将此公式向下复制到B3单元格时,公式会变为“=A3$D$1”。可以看到,参照的金额A2相对地变成了A3,但税率引用$D$1始终保持不变。 案例二:制作九九乘法表时,通常需要同时锁定行和列。在B2单元格输入公式“=$A2B$1”,然后向四周复制,可以快速生成整个乘法表。这里$A2锁定了A列,行号相对变化;B$1锁定了第1行,列标相对变化。 四、混合引用的灵活性 混合引用是相对引用和绝对引用的结合体,它只锁定行或只锁定列。这种灵活性使得它在处理二维表格数据时尤为强大,可以仅让引用在一个方向上(行或列)发生变化,而另一个方向保持固定。 案例一:在一个销售数据表中,行是产品名称,列是月份。要计算每个产品每个月占该产品全年总额的百分比,分母需要锁定产品所在的行(绝对行,相对列),而分子则是该产品指定月份的销售额(相对引用)。公式可能形如“=B2/SUM($B2:$M2)”,其中列标B和M前没有$,行号2前有$,这样公式向右复制时,求和的区域会从B2:M2变为C2:N2,但行号始终锁定在第2行,确保始终计算的是同一产品的年度总和。 案例二:在计算跨页引用时,有时需要固定工作表名称而让单元格引用相对变化,这也可以看作是一种特殊的混合引用应用。 五、三维引用的跨工作表操作能力 区域引用不仅仅局限于单个工作表内,它强大的三维引用特性允许我们同时引用多个连续工作表中的相同单元格区域。这对于汇总结构完全相同的多个分表数据(如各月报表、各部门报表)来说,是极其高效的工具。 案例一:假设一个工作簿中有名为“一月”、“二月”、“三月”的三个工作表,每个工作表的A1单元格都存放着当月的销售额。要计算第一季度总销售额,可以在汇总表单元格中输入公式“=SUM(一月:三月!A1)”。这个“一月:三月!A1”就是一个三维引用,它一次性引用了三个工作表中相同位置的单元格。 案例二:如果需要汇总三个工作表中从A1到A10的区域数据,公式可以写为“=SUM(一月:三月!A1:A10)”。这样就能快速得到所有工作表指定区域的总和,无需逐个工作表相加。 六、为区域定义名称以提升可读性与维护性 我们可以为任何一个单元格或区域赋予一个易于理解和记忆的名称,之后在公式中就可以使用这个名称来代替复杂的单元格地址引用。这极大地增强了公式的可读性,也方便后续对数据范围的修改和维护。 案例一:将存放员工基本工资的区域“B2:B100”定义名称为“基本工资”,将绩效工资区域“C2:C100”定义名称为“绩效工资”。那么计算总工资的公式就可以从晦涩的“=SUM(B2:B100, C2:C100)”变为清晰明了的“=SUM(基本工资, 绩效工资)”。 案例二:如果后续员工人数增加,只需要在名称管理器中修改“基本工资”和“绩效工资”所指向的区域范围(例如改为B2:B150),所有使用这些名称的公式都会自动更新引用范围,无需逐个修改公式。 七、动态数组公式中的溢出引用 在现代版本的表格处理软件中,引入了一项革命性的功能——动态数组。当一个公式的计算结果是多个值(一个数组)时,结果会自动“溢出”到相邻的空白单元格中,形成动态区域。引用这个结果区域时,会显示为“”符号,这代表了动态的、可自动调整大小的区域引用。 案例一:使用“=SORT(A2:A10)”函数对A2:A10区域进行排序。当在B2单元格输入此公式并按下回车后,排序后的结果会从B2单元格开始,自动向下填充到所需的行数。这个结果区域B2:B10(假设有9个结果)就是一个动态溢出区域。 案例二:如果源数据A2:A10发生变化,例如增加或减少了数据,这个动态溢出区域的大小会自动调整,引用它的其他公式也会自动获取更新后的全部结果,无需手动干预。 八、在条件格式和数据有效性中的应用 区域引用是设置条件格式规则和数据有效性(数据验证)的基础。通过指定一个区域,我们可以对这片区域内的所有单元格统一应用格式规则或输入限制,实现批量、智能化的数据管理和可视化。 案例一:选中成绩区域“C2:C50”,设置条件格式规则为“当单元格值小于60时,将单元格背景色设置为红色”。这里,“C2:C50”就是条件格式应用的目标区域。 案例二:为“部门”列(假设为D2:D100)设置数据有效性,限制只能从下拉列表中选择“销售部”、“技术部”、“财务部”等预定义的部门名称。在数据有效性的“来源”框中,需要引用存放这些部门名称的区域(例如F2:F5),或者直接输入用逗号分隔的文本。 九、与查找与引用类函数的深度结合 诸如垂直查找(VLOOKUP)、索引(INDEX)与匹配(MATCH)组合等强大的查找函数,其核心参数都依赖于精确的区域引用。引用的准确与否,直接决定了查找结果的正确性。 案例一:使用VLOOKUP函数根据员工工号在员工信息表中查找对应的姓名。公式通常为“=VLOOKUP(查找工号, 信息表区域, 姓名所在列号, FALSE)”。这里的“信息表区域”必须是一个包含查找值和返回值的完整区域引用,例如A2:D100。 案例二:更灵活的INDEX和MATCH组合。公式“=INDEX(C2:C100, MATCH(查找值, A2:A100, 0))”中,INDEX函数需要引用返回值所在的区域(C2:C100),MATCH函数需要引用查找值所在的区域(A2:A100)。这两个区域引用的行数必须一致,才能确保匹配正确。 十、结构化引用在表格对象中的便捷性 当我们把一片普通区域转换为正式的“表格”对象后,就可以使用更具可读性的结构化引用。结构化引用使用表格名称、列标题名等元素来代替传统的行列地址,使得公式看起来就像在阅读自然语言。 案例一:将一个区域A1:D100转换为表格并命名为“销售记录”。要计算“金额”列的总和,公式可以写为“=SUM(销售记录[金额])”,这比“=SUM(D2:D100)”要直观得多。 案例二:在表格中新增一行数据时,所有基于结构化引用的公式(如汇总行、计算列)会自动将新数据纳入计算范围,无需手动调整引用区域,体现了其智能化的特点。 十一、区域引用的动态扩展特性 某些函数和特性支持区域的动态扩展。这意味着引用的区域不是固定不变的,而是可以根据周边数据的存在与否自动调整其大小。这在与动态数组等功能结合时尤为明显。 案例一:使用“=A1”来引用由A1单元格溢出的动态数组的全部内容。无论这个动态数组有多少行、多少列,“A1”这个引用都会自动涵盖整个溢出区域。 案例二:在一些旧版本中,使用偏移(OFFSET)函数与计数(COUNTA)函数结合,可以创建一个动态的命名区域。例如,定义一个名称“动态数据区域”,其引用位置为“=OFFSET($A$1,0,0,COUNTA($A:$A),1)”。这个区域会随着A列非空单元格数量的变化而自动向下扩展或收缩。 十二、区域大小的快速识别与调整 软件提供了便捷的方式让我们快速识别和调整已选区域的大小。当选中一个区域时,状态栏通常会显示该区域的平均值、计数、求和等概要信息。同时,我们可以通过拖动区域边框的控制点来直观地调整引用范围。 案例一:用鼠标选中一片数值区域后,无需输入任何公式,只需看向窗口底部的状态栏,就能立刻看到这些数值的个数、平均值、求和值等,方便快速核对。 案例二:在编辑栏中选中公式内的某个区域引用(如“A1:B5”),此时工作表中对应的区域会被一个彩色的边框框选出来。我们可以直接拖动这个边框来扩大或缩小引用的区域,公式中的引用地址会随之实时改变。 十三、在数据透视表与图表中的基础作用 创建数据透视表和图表的第一步,就是指定源数据区域。区域引用的准确性直接决定了数据分析的广度和深度。一个错误的区域引用可能导致数据透视表缺失关键信息或包含冗余数据。 案例一:创建数据透视表时,软件通常会自动识别一个连续的数据区域作为建议区域。但如果我们的数据表中间存在空行或空列,自动识别可能会出错。此时就需要手动输入或选择正确的数据区域引用,确保包含了所有需要分析的行和列。 案例二:当源数据区域新增了行或列后,数据透视表需要刷新才能反映最新数据。如果希望数据透视表能自动扩展源数据区域,可以事先将源数据转换为表格对象,或者使用动态命名区域作为数据源。 十四、区域引用错误提示与排查 当区域引用出现问题时,例如引用了不存在的单元格或被删除的工作表,软件会显示特定的错误值(如“REF!”)。理解这些错误值的含义,是快速定位和修复公式问题的关键技能。 案例一:如果一个公式原本引用的是“Sheet1!A1”,但“Sheet1”工作表被删除了,那么公式就会显示为“REF!”,表示引用无效。 案例二:如果使用VLOOKUP函数时,指定的查找列索引号超过了引用区域的总列数,函数会返回“REF!”错误。这时就需要检查区域引用范围是否正确,以及列索引号是否在有效范围内。 十五、跨工作簿引用的外部关联性 区域引用可以跨越当前工作簿,链接到其他外部工作簿中的单元格或区域。这使得我们能够整合分散在不同文件中的数据。但需要注意的是,这种外部引用依赖于源文件的路径和名称,如果源文件被移动或重命名,链接可能会中断。 案例一:在当前工作簿的单元格中,可以输入公式“=[预算.xlsx]Sheet1!$B$5”来引用“预算.xlsx”这个外部工作簿中Sheet1工作表的B5单元格的值。 案例二:当打开一个包含外部引用的工作簿时,软件可能会提示是否更新链接以获取最新的外部数据。如果选择更新,软件会尝试按照存储的路径去寻找源文件并刷新数据。 十六、区域引用的计算优先级与求值顺序 在复杂的嵌套公式中,包含多个区域引用的部分会按照运算符的优先级和函数的参数顺序进行求值。理解这一点有助于我们编写正确且高效的公式,尤其是在使用易失性函数时。 案例一:公式“=SUM(A1:A10) AVERAGE(B1:B10)”,会先分别计算SUM函数和AVERAGE函数引用的区域,然后再将两个结果相乘。 案例二:使用F9键可以分段计算公式。在编辑栏中选中公式的一部分(如“A1:A10”),按下F9,可以看到这部分引用的区域被立即计算出的结果数组所替代,这有助于我们逐步调试和理解复杂的公式逻辑。 通过以上十六个方面的深入探讨,我们可以看到,区域引用远不止是选中一片格子那么简单。它是连接数据、公式、函数和各类高级功能的桥梁和纽带。从最基础的相对绝对引用,到高级的动态数组和结构化引用,每一项特性都旨在提升我们处理数据的效率和准确性。希望这篇文章能帮助您重新审视并熟练掌握区域引用这一强大工具,让您在数据处理的道路上更加得心应手。
相关文章
掌握Excel中金额计算的高效方法对财务工作至关重要。本文系统梳理了十二个核心场景下的关键公式与应用技巧,涵盖基础算术运算、条件求和、跨表引用及金融计算等实用场景。每个技巧均配以贴近实际工作的案例说明,帮助用户快速提升数据处理能力与准确性,实现专业级的金额自动化核算。
2025-11-01 17:43:07
106人看过
当用户打开Excel时发现可用列数受限,这种现象背后涉及软件架构设计、数据规范优化和性能平衡等多重因素。本文通过16个技术维度系统解析列限制的底层逻辑,涵盖版本差异兼容性、内存管理机制、界面交互设计等专业领域,并结合实际应用场景说明合理规划数据结构的解决方案,帮助用户突破工具限制提升数据处理效率。
2025-11-01 17:42:49
204人看过
最终状态在表格处理软件中指的是数据处理流程完成后形成的稳定数据形态,它既包含数据表结构、数值内容等静态特征,也涵盖条件格式、数据验证规则等动态属性。理解最终状态的概念有助于建立规范的数据存档机制,提升多版本协作效率。本文将通过十二个维度系统解析最终状态的判定标准与管理策略。
2025-11-01 17:42:46
304人看过
本文将全面解析Excel宏的18个核心应用场景,涵盖数据处理自动化、报表生成优化、系统功能扩展等方向。通过具体案例演示如何利用宏提升工作效率,包括自动数据清洗、智能格式转换、动态图表生成等实用技巧,帮助用户从基础操作进阶到自动化办公。
2025-11-01 17:42:19
363人看过
当我们使用文档处理软件进行文字编辑时,经常会遇到一个令人困惑的现象:文字下方出现了类似下划线但由密集小点构成的横线。这些横点并非简单的装饰,其背后隐藏着文档处理软件复杂的排版逻辑和丰富的功能设计。本文将深入剖析横点产生的十二大核心原因,从基础格式设置到高级协作功能,结合具体操作案例,为您提供一套完整的识别与解决方案。
2025-11-01 17:42:15
125人看过
微软电子表格软件2010版(Excel 2010)的编辑功能体系涵盖数据处理、可视化分析与自动化操作三大维度。本文将系统解析十二项核心编辑能力,包括改进的功能区界面(Ribbon)、实时协作编辑、条件格式增强、数据透视表切片器、公式追踪工具等实用功能。通过具体操作案例演示如何运用这些工具提升工作效率,为职场人士提供完整的功能导航与实操指南。
2025-11-01 17:42:04
137人看过
热门推荐
资讯中心:
.webp)
.webp)


.webp)
.webp)